Dock Street Asset Management Inc. trimmed its position in shares of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R - Free Report) by 5.5% in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 1,016,008 shares of the company's stock after selling 59,263 shares during the period. Palantir Technologies accounts for approximately 13.0% of Dock Street Asset Management Inc.'s holdings, making the stock its 2nd biggest position. Dock Street Asset Management Inc.'s holdings in Palantir Technologies were worth $138,502,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Palantir Technologies Price Performance
PLTR stock opened at $179.74 on Wednesday. Palantir Technologies Inc. has a 52-week low of $40.36 and a 52-week high of $190.00. The company's 50 day simple moving average is $171.78 and its 200-day simple moving average is $141.31. The firm has a market capitalization of $426.40 billion, a P/E ratio of 599.15, a P/E/G ratio of 9.61 and a beta of 2.60.
Palantir Technologies (NASDAQ:PLTR -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Monday, August 4th. The company reported $0.16 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.02. Palantir Technologies had a net margin of 22.18% and a return on equity of 10.75%. The business had revenue of $1 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$939.29 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$0.09 earnings per share. The firm's revenue was up 48.0% compared to the same quarter last year. Palantir Technologies Company Profile

Palantir Technologies, Inc engages in the business of building and deploying software platforms that serve as the central operating systems for its customers. It operates under the Commercial and Government segments. The Commercial segment focuses on customers working in non-government industries. The Government segment is involved in providing services to customers that are the United States government and non-United States government agencies.
